Treasure Coast Setting

Sebastian is a city in Indian River County, Florida, along the Indian River Lagoon near the Atlantic. It blends waterfront neighborhoods with a relaxed Old Florida feel.

Population and Districts

Families, retirees, and seasonal residents live in canal-front streets, quiet cul-de-sacs, and river-view enclaves. Local schools and parks shape community rhythms.

History

Fishing, citrus, and railroads drove early growth. The city preserves riverfront heritage through parks, piers, and community festivals.

Economy

Employment includes marine services, tourism, healthcare, retail, and light manufacturing. Nearby beaches and wildlife areas attract visitors and support small business.

Culture

Art shows, seafood events, and live music energize public spaces. Nature centers interpret the biodiverse lagoon ecosystem.

Outdoors

Kayaking, boating, manatee and bird watching, and surf-fishing are everyday pursuits. Trails and preserves offer hiking and photography.
